Trovata: Signs global distribution deal with Banco Santander

Trovata: Signs global distribution deal with Banco Santander

  • Trovata makes it easy for businesses to automate cash reporting, forecasting, analysis, and money movement
  • Banco Santander is a leading commercial bank, founded in 1857 and headquartered in Spain
  • Announced a global distribution agreement with Santander
  • Through the partnership, Santander will market & refer cash management platform to its corporate & investment banking clients
  • Santander offers its clients a way to digitally transform its cash operating workflows – automated cash reporting
  • Aggregates and transforms corporate banking data at scale and that automates much of the cash forecasting process
